Family Night Survival Hike

  • Ernie Miller Nature Center Ernie Miller Park Program Shelter #2 909 N. Highway 7, Olathe, KS (map)

Learn tips to stay safe and make it home

Join Johnson County Parks and Recreation for an educational evening hike through the forest. Your group will visit stations throughout the park and learn about techniques to help you survive if you’re ever lost in the woods after dark. Headlamps and other sources of light will be provided.

Cost $12 Johnson County residents; $13 for non-residents

Audience Ages 6 and older

Register The group size is limited and registration is required.
